#4cc4d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cc4d4 is composed of 29.8% red, 76.9%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 187.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 56.5%. #4cc4d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#0089a9.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#4cc4d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a0b is the darkest color, while #fafd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4cc4d4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889698 is the less saturated color, while #21e5ff is the most saturated one.
